Elon Musk's Terafab Project Seeks Chipmaking Suppliers
Elon Musk's staff has reportedly contacted various suppliers, including Applied Materials, Tokyo Electron, and Lam Research, to accelerate his new Terafab chipmaking project. Musk is urging suppliers to move at "light speed" to support this ambitious plan.

Elon Musk's staff seeks price quotes and delivery times for an array of chipmaking gear, contacting makers of photomasks, substrates, etchers, depositors, cleaning devices, testers, and other tools.
